Admission Procedure
ELIGIBILITY
FULL TIME PHD
B. Tech / M. Tech in Aerospace, Aeronautical, Mechanical, Automobile, Civil, Electrical and Electronics Engineering, and Equivalent Degrees.
applicants are expected to have strong academic records.
PART TIME PHD
Applicants who have a full-time appointment at Amrita Vishwa Vidyapeetham or at another academic/ R&D organization are eligible to apply for part-time admission. Other eligibility requirements of such applicants are same as full time applicants. Part Time students are permitted to proceed at a slower pace in completing their doctoral requirements.
INTEGRATED PHD
Exceptional students pursuing a Bachelor's or Master's degree at Amrita will be allowed to apply for the Integrated Ph.D. program subject to the requirement that he or she completes all the requirements of the Bachelor's or Master's degree prior to 'advancement to candidacy'
DUAL DEGREE PHD
Exceptional students who satisfy the eligibility requirements of Amrita and that of Amrita's International Partner University (IPU), as stated in the Dual PhD. MoU signed between Amrita and the IPU, are eligible for admission to the Dual PhD program.
